Tucked away in the charming riverside town of Bideford, East Of The Water Chinese Menu offers a hearty lineup of classic Chinese takeaway favourites that cater to both the traditionalist and the curious foodie. Located at 2 Barnstaple St, this small but mighty spot blends comfort food with authentic flavours, making it a go-to for locals seeking satisfying, well-prepared dishes.

From the first bite of their aromatic crispy aromatic duck to the generous portions of sweet and sour chicken, the menu is packed with all the expected staples-but done with consistency and care. Their chow mein stands out for its balance between texture and flavour, neither too greasy nor over-sauced, while their beef in black bean sauce impresses with tender cuts and a punchy umami profile. Portion sizes are notably generous, easily stretching into leftovers, which adds to the value proposition.

What sets East Of The Water apart from many competitors is the speed and friendliness of service, whether you're popping in to collect or calling for delivery. Their phone order system is straightforward, and dishes typically arrive hot and well-packaged-key details that elevate the overall experience. While the menu isn’t overloaded with adventurous or modern takes, its focus on getting the classics right is where it shines.

That said, some may find the décor and presentation rather modest, as this is more of a grab-and-go or cosy-night-in kind of place than a dine-in destination. But for what it offers-reliable Chinese takeaway that satisfies your cravings without breaking the bank-it does the job exceptionally well.

Whether you’re a local or just passing through Bideford, the East Of The Water Chinese Menu delivers flavourful comfort that’s hard to fault and easy to return to.
